SQL SERVER字段一列复制另一列

在SQL SERVER中,有时候我们需要将一个字段的值复制到另一个字段中。这可能是因为需要对数据进行一些处理,或者是为了满足某些业务需求。在本文中,我们将详细讨论如何使用SQL SERVER来实现这一功能。

1. 创建示例表格

首先,让我们创建一个示例表格,包含两列:source_columntarget_column。我们将使用这个表格来演示如何将source_column中的值复制到target_column中。

| id | source_column | target_column |
|----|---------------|---------------|
| 1  | Value 1       |               |
| 2  | Value 2       |               |
| 3  | Value 3       |               |

2. 使用UPDATE语句复制字段值

要将source_column中的值复制到target_column中,我们可以使用UPDATE语句来实现。下面是具体的SQL代码示例:

UPDATE table_name
SET target_column = source_column

在这个示例中,table_name是我们的表格名称,target_column是我们要复制到的目标字段,source_column是我们要复制的源字段。通过执行这条UPDATE语句,我们可以将source_column中的值复制到target_column中。

3. 示例代码

接下来,让我们使用实际的代码示例来演示如何将source_column中的值复制到target_column中。假设我们有一个名为example_table的表格,其结构如下:

CREATE TABLE example_table (
    id INT,
    source_column VARCHAR(50),
    target_column VARCHAR(50)
);

INSERT INTO example_table (id, source_column) VALUES (1, 'Value 1');
INSERT INTO example_table (id, source_column) VALUES (2, 'Value 2');
INSERT INTO example_table (id, source_column) VALUES (3, 'Value 3');

现在,我们可以使用以下UPDATE语句来将source_column中的值复制到target_column中:

UPDATE example_table
SET target_column = source_column;

执行这条UPDATE语句后,我们的表格数据将会变成如下所示:

id source_column target_column
1 Value 1 Value 1
2 Value 2 Value 2
3 Value 3 Value 3

4. 总结

在本文中,我们详细介绍了如何使用SQL SERVER来将一个字段的值复制到另一个字段中。通过使用UPDATE语句,我们可以轻松地实现这一功能,满足我们的业务需求。希望本文能够帮助到您,谢谢阅读!

stateDiagram
    [*] --> Update
    Update --> [*]

通过上面的示例,我们可以看到如何使用SQL语句将一个字段的值复制到另一个字段中。这种操作在日常的数据处理中非常常见,希望本文对您有所帮助。如果您有任何疑问或建议,请随时与我们联系。感谢阅读!